Music from Plants

Apparently this music is the sound of plant vibrations, transmitted by sensors attached to the leaves and roots. The technique was developed at a neo-pagan eco-commune in northern Italy called Damanhur. They make the astonishing claim that the plants “learn” to tune their electric signals to obtain melodies.
